What can I study?

In 2012, you can choose from:

  • accounting
  • algorithmic problem solving/computer programming
  • Australian history/politics
  • biology
  • biomedical science
  • business management
  • computer systems/computer programming
  • chemistry
  • criminal justice studies
  • geography
  • Japanese
  • Japanese for background speakers
  • mathematics
  • philosophy
  • physics
  • studies in religion
